Block

#18,581,409
Block Number
18,581,409 @ 05/22/2024, 01:38:50
Status
Finalized
ID
0x011b87a120c6de7fdfdd5e302a48851d957a610b3b2b3efeb1e56286877bb3a2
Transactions
Gas Used
311473/40000000 (0.78% Used)
Total Score
1,810,915,330 (+96)
Rewards
0.93 VTHO